Develop and enhance ServiceNow applications, workflows, UI policies, business rules, integrations, and custom components following platform best practices.
Build and maintain ServiceNow Portal components (Angular/Seismic) where applicable.
Create scalable, maintainable technical solutions to solve complex business problems.
Configure and extend modules such as ITSM, CMDB, Asset, App Engine, and custom scoped applications.
Design, implement, and optimize data models, forms, ACLs, client/server scripts, UI actions, and Flow Designer automations.
Investigate, triage, and resolve client and operational issues, performing root cause analysis and implementing long-term solutions.
Maintain detailed documentation of configurations, development work, and system behaviors.
Work directly with clients, product managers, operations, and project management to define requirements and ensure timely delivery of solutions.
Participate in Agile ceremonies, sprint planning, code reviews, and knowledge sharing within the engineering team.
Requirements
2-4+ years of hands-on ServiceNow development and administration experience.
Experience supporting or developing within ITSM, CMDB, Asset, App Engine, or Portal modules.
Experience developing with JavaScript on the ServiceNow platform, including Script Includes, Business Rules, Client Scripts, and UI policies/actions.
Strong understanding of ServiceNow architecture, scoped applications, update sets, and release management.
Experience with REST/SOAP integrations, Flow Designer, and Integration Hub.
Familiarity with web technologies: JavaScript, HTML, AngularJS, JSON, XML, and API-driven development.
Bachelor’s degree in computer science, Information Systems, Engineering, or equivalent practical experience (preferred).